Dirty 30 bloke made bombs out of SEGA cartridges

Not out of Sony batteries
Tuesday, 4 November 2008, 07:52

ONE OF THE BLOKES in the Guantánamo Bay detention centre apparently made a name for himself making bombs out of old SEGA cartridges.

The New York Times has been looking at what will happen when a new President takes control of the US and works out what to do with the legally dodgy prison camp. Senators John McCain and Barack Obama have said they would close the detention camp when they take office but there remains a problem about what to do with the 255 people banged up there.

Apparently the prison contains one Hassan Bin Attash, a teenage detainee – who was one of the 'Dirty 30' who were bodyguards for Osama bin Laden – captured early in the Afghanistan war.

Attash was probably tortured, but confessed to making detonators out of old SEGA cartridges, we assume to make everyone go Sonic.

The Yemeni – who has received little public attention, particularly from the gaming community – was originally selected by Mr bin Laden as a potential September 11 hijacker. Apparently his bomb making skills were considered a bit too jolly useful.

Of course it is not clear how useful SEGA bomb making skills will be if Attash ever gets out. There are not too many people using the cartridges any more and you can't really stuff a bomb into a second generation disk. µ
